Two agents spar over one codebase until every review finding is reconciled.
Hubo
双手互搏
Two hands spar over every change. Only real decisions reach you.
Zhou Botong is one of wuxia's great eccentrics: a legendary martial artist with the temperament of a mischievous child. When ordinary practice becomes too ordinary, he invents something delightfully absurd — the Technique of Ambidexterity (双手互搏).
He teaches each hand to act independently. One hand attacks; the other answers. Each uses a different martial art. The same person becomes both opponents, and the sparring continues until neither hand can surprise the other.
It sounds like a party trick. It is actually a discipline: split creation from criticism, give both sides room to think, and let disagreement expose what either side would miss alone.
Hubo puts that little duel inside your coding agent.
The name comes from 互搏 (hùbó): to spar with each other. Not two agents politely taking turns, and not a reviewer saying “looks good” from the doorway. Two hands spar over every change. Only real decisions reach you. They exchange evidence until the code — not either agent's ego — wins.
Before / after
Without Hubo, an agent implements the feature, runs a test, reviews its own reasoning, and hands the result to you. The author, tester, and reviewer all share the same blind spots.
With Hubo:
your task
↓
work agent ── implementation + evidence ──▶ review agent
▲ │
└──── fix or reasoned pushback ◀───────┘
repeat
↓
reconciled result — or you
You see the work only after every concrete finding is resolved, unless the remaining question genuinely requires your judgment.
How it works
Hubo keeps two persistent roles in the same conversation:
| Hand | Role |
|---|---|
| Work agent | Understands the task, changes the code, tests it, and answers every review finding with a fix or evidence-based pushback. |
| Review agent | Stays independent and read-only, inspects the actual diff and verification evidence, and returns numbered, actionable findings. |
| Coordinator | Carries messages between them, preserves unresolved findings across rounds, and stops only at a real exit condition. |
The loop ends when:
- the reviewer clears the work and every finding is reconciled; or
- the agents identify a product, requirement, or technical-direction decision that only you can make.
The reviewer may spawn specialists. The worker may delegate implementation. But at the top level the shape remains the same: one hand makes, one hand tests the making.
Hubo is explicit-only. It does nothing until you invoke it; ordinary coding prompts remain ordinary.
Install
Claude Code
Run these as two separate prompts:
/plugin marketplace add h0ngcha0/hubo
/plugin install hubo@hubo
Then run /reload-plugins or start a new conversation.
Codex
codex plugin marketplace add h0ngcha0/hubo
codex plugin add hubo@hubo
Restart Codex and start a new conversation so the skill is discovered.
GitHub Copilot CLI
copilot plugin marketplace add h0ngcha0/hubo
copilot plugin install hubo@hubo
Start a new Copilot CLI session after installing.
OpenClaw
openclaw plugins install hubo --marketplace h0ngcha0/hubo
Restart the OpenClaw gateway after installing.
skills.sh
Install Hubo directly into any supported host:
npx skills add h0ngcha0/hubo --skill hubo -g

Requirements
Hubo needs a host that can create and resume two addressable agents and return both agents' results to the coordinator. This repository currently packages adapters for Claude Code, Codex, GitHub Copilot CLI, and OpenClaw.
The workflow preserves pre-existing worktree changes, keeps the reviewer read-only, accepts justified pushback, and favors root-cause fixes over patches that merely silence a symptom.
